| Title: | Mortgage Stone Fragment | |
| Category: | Inscriptions | |
| Description: | Inscribed fragment. Part of back preserved; roughly tooled. Five lines of the inscription preserved, trace of sixth above. Hymettian marble. | |
| Context: | Found in mixed Byzantine and late context north of the Roman bath in the industrial area, southwest of the Market Square. | |
